X-Git-Url: http://git.rot13.org/?p=perl-cwmp.git;a=blobdiff_plain;f=Makefile.PL;h=98967749bbb20bed86f98d6d6ce49d3da02268f5;hp=e46ad2b8fffffb57f3501156a6544180ee4e599b;hb=ca6ef25dcfcb37bd49839770139c8568de69471c;hpb=930578002bc2ae59d2f550a1b458d29d605f966d diff --git a/Makefile.PL b/Makefile.PL index e46ad2b..9896774 100644 --- a/Makefile.PL +++ b/Makefile.PL @@ -21,21 +21,39 @@ requires 'Getopt::Long'; requires 'Module::Pluggable'; requires 'YAML'; requires 'Hash::Merge'; +requires 'IPC::DirQueue'; +requires 'File::Spec'; +requires 'File::Path'; build_requires 'Test::More'; features( 'Command-line access to modems (tcli.pl)' => [ -default => 1, - requires('Expect'), - requires('Net::Telnet'), + recommends('Expect'), + recommends('Net::Telnet'), ], ); +features( + 'HTML documentation (make html)' => [ + -default => 0, + recommends('Pod::Xhtml'), + ], +); + +features( + 'Pod coverage tests (for developers)' => [ + -default => 0, + recommends('Test::Pod::Coverage'), + ], +); + +; my_targets(); -clean_files('dump/* yaml state.db html t/var/*'); +clean_files('dump/* yaml state.db html t/var/* queue'); auto_install;